NBA fans should remember point guards Roko Ukic (85 games with the Raptors and Bucks) and Zoran Planinic (three seasons with the Nets), who can both get into the lane and make plays. Tomas will likely be their top scorer for the tournament, but big man Ante Tomic will be the guy that the U.S. will have to worry most about.

When we bring up Gasol and Tomic in the same sentence let's be careful.
Tomic kind of looks like Gasol or Gasol like, he moves well in the post, and has a soft touch around the basket.
He still doesn't block shots like Gasol or like he should at that height. We all know he needs to bulk up etc.

Please don't expect Tomic to be a Gasol clone.
He's not right now and will probably never be. He's just got a few things that are similar, and that's it.

With that said, I'm very excited about Tomic. Have been all along.

1. He's still improving. This is the most exciting thing. He hasn't reached his ceiling yet. So we really don't know for sure just what he'll pan out to be.
2. We've got nothing to lose with him. He was a second round stash. (i love these types of picks).
3. His size. Always exciting to watch big men prospects. Being a Jazz fan just leaves us salivating for his length.
4. He's a nice trade chip. The more exposure he gets the more his trade value rises. Not saying we want to trade him, but it's always nice to have. He's got value right now, and it is only going up.
5. He's so quick. (Yes, he does look awkward at times too) This ability to move so well will come in handy in the quick NBA game.

I don't think Tomic will end up being as good as Gasol or a star in the NBA. He could be, but the odds are against it. I'm not expecting it.
I do think he will be a good back up Center for us. A quaility player who adds to our squad. That is my hope, and my honest prediction.
